Position Overview:
The Property Accounting Manager will oversee the financial operations of multiple real estate entities and projects, ensuring accuracy in reporting, compliance, and strategic insights. This role combines financial management, client relationship oversight, tax compliance, and process improvement while managing and mentoring a team.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Administer financial software systems (MRI, AVID, Treasury Management) for daily operations.

  • Build and maintain strong client relationships, offering expert financial guidance.

  • Manage financial analyses including balance sheets, depreciation schedules, draws, and escrow distributions.

  • Contribute to business planning, reporting, and forecasting to support decision-making.

  • Monitor and manage cash flow and capital requirements for development projects.

  • Review CAM budgets for accuracy and compliance.

  • Support tax filings for multiple entities and assist CPA firms with required documentation.

  • Oversee insurance programs and audits for company operations and projects.

  • Manage project lending and draw processes for development financing.

  • Develop and manage budgets for corporate operations and projects.

  • Collaborate on process improvements to strengthen internal controls and efficiency.

Qualifications:

  • 15–20 years of property accounting experience in real estate management and development.

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or related field.

  • Strong proficiency in Yardi (required), MRI, and Timeline.

  • Advanced Excel skills with the ability to conduct complex financial analysis.

  • Proven leadership experience managing direct reports.

  • Strong analytical, organizational, and decision-making abilities.
